In traditional writing, there is restriction on using first person but the whole reflective report is provided in … deistically definitionWebNov 2, 2024 · Both the language and the structure are important for academic reflective writing. For the structure you want to mirror an academic essay closely. You want an introduction, a main body, and a conclusion. Academic reflection will require you to both describe the context, analyse it, and make conclusions. However, there is not one set of … feng shui east facing front door colors
